A violation is a notice the Department of Buildings recorded against the building. It is not a judgment, and many concern paperwork rather than safety. Open means the agency has not recorded a resolution, which is not the same as the problem still existing. From NYC Department of Buildings, DOB Violations (3h2n-5cm9), accessed Sep 14, 2026.
